What I do is use a shovel or paths to count the grass tiles along the topmost left side all the way to the topmost right. Worst best when your island is flat, but doable even if it isn't, but requires some laddering, probably, lol.
Then, once you have the back correct, go down the side edges, and then the frontmost and ensure that it all looks the same. The beach is not nearly as inconsequential to be exact, but you'll want all the outer grass tiles to be correct! The inner will of course always be fine as long as outer is. :]
